Police in Limpopo have arrested a fourth suspect in connection with the R10 million insurance murder, fraud, and money laundering case involving former police officer Rachel Kutumela and her family.
A 54-year-old man, who is the brother of Rachel Kutumela, was apprehended on Tuesday morning around 11:00 in Moletjie, outside Seshego.
He is expected to appear before the Polokwane Magistrateโs Court on Wednesday, 5 November 2025, where he will face charges of murder, fraud, and money laundering.
The case has gripped the province since the arrest of Kutumela and her co-accused, her sister Anna Shokane (47) and daughter Florah Shokane (23), who remain in custody after being denied bail.
The trioโs case has since been transferred to the Polokwane High Court.
